#739015 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#739015 is composed of 45.1% red, 56.5%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.4%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 74.1 degrees, a saturation of 74.5% and a lightness of 32.4%. #739015 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ff2a with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

● #739015 color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
The hexadecimal color #739015 has RGB values of R:115, G:144,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 7573525.
